From: JP Thornley <jpt@diphi.demon.co.uk>
Subject: Re: Need help with PowerPC/Ada and realtime tasking
Date: 1996/05/31
Date: 1996-05-31T00:00:00+00:00 [thread overview]
Message-ID: <152267236wnr@diphi.demon.co.uk> (raw)
In-Reply-To: 1996May30.103842.17355@ocsystems.com
In article: <1996May30.103842.17355@ocsystems.com> rec@ocsystems.com
(Ralph E. Crafts) writes:
> I don't believe that Phil is accurate
> in his statement that Ada 95 compilers "won't be usable" in the period
> from now to 1998-2000.
This thread is about safety-critical software and "usable" has to be
seen in that context.
Ralph, you may by now have seen my post on what it takes for us to
accept a compiler - that post and your's crossed in my modem.
In particular there are severe requirements on what is a suitably mature
compiler for us to start to look at it. I haven't connected to see any
responses to that post yet, but I'll be disappointed if no-one mentions
GNAT (because I've made a bet with myself that some-one will). However
I imagine that GNAT would fail on stability grounds at the moment -
there are clearly lots of users and lots of different sorts of use, but
unless *one version* of it gets long-term usage, it can't be considered
mature.
Your reference to continuing to add features suggests that PowerAda is
in the same position. (Please don't take this as a criticism - it's a
simple fact of life in the current state of the development of Ada 95
as a language.)
I often worry that safety-critical software development makes heavy
demands on the supporting tools and the market for those tools is very
small (I've seen a figure of 1% of Ada being safety-critical) so that
long term vendor support must be questionable. And I'll continue to
worry even though at least two compiler vendors seem to be investing in
this area at the moment.
Phil Thornley
--
------------------------------------------------------------------------
| JP Thornley EMail jpt@diphi.demon.co.uk |
------------------------------------------------------------------------
next prev parent reply other threads:[~1996-05-31 0:00 UTC|newest]
Thread overview: 39+ messages / expand[flat|nested] mbox.gz Atom feed top
1996-05-17 0:00 Need help with PowerPC/Ada and realtime tasking Dave Struble
1996-05-18 0:00 ` JP Thornley
1996-05-20 0:00 ` Robert I. Eachus
1996-05-21 0:00 ` Michael Levasseur
1996-05-21 0:00 ` Richard Riehle
1996-05-25 0:00 ` JP Thornley
1996-05-27 0:00 ` Darren C Davenport
1996-05-30 0:00 ` Ralph E. Crafts
1996-05-31 0:00 ` JP Thornley [this message]
1996-06-03 0:00 ` Ken Garlington
1996-05-28 0:00 ` Tasking in safety-critical software (!) (was Re: Need help with PowerPC/Ada and realtime tasking) Kevin F. Quinn
1996-05-25 0:00 ` Need help with PowerPC/Ada and realtime tasking JP Thornley
1996-05-27 0:00 ` Robert Dewar
1996-05-28 0:00 ` JP Thornley
1996-05-29 0:00 ` Ken Garlington
1996-05-29 0:00 ` Robert A Duff
1996-05-30 0:00 ` JP Thornley
1996-05-31 0:00 ` Ken Garlington
1996-06-02 0:00 ` JP Thornley
1996-06-03 0:00 ` Ken Garlington
1996-05-30 0:00 ` Software Safety (was: Need help with PowerPC/Ada and realtime tasking) Ken Garlington
1996-05-30 0:00 ` Robert Dewar
1996-06-02 0:00 ` JP Thornley
1996-06-03 0:00 ` Robert A Duff
1996-06-05 0:00 ` Norman H. Cohen
1996-06-07 0:00 ` Ken Garlington
1996-06-12 0:00 ` Norman H. Cohen
1996-06-12 0:00 ` Ken Garlington
1996-06-08 0:00 ` Robert Dewar
1996-06-08 0:00 ` Robert A Duff
1996-05-31 0:00 ` Robert A Duff
1996-06-03 0:00 ` Ken Garlington
1996-05-28 0:00 ` Need help with PowerPC/Ada and realtime tasking Robert I. Eachus
1996-05-30 0:00 ` JP Thornley
1996-06-03 0:00 ` Ken Garlington
1996-05-28 0:00 ` Robert I. Eachus
1996-05-30 0:00 ` JP Thornley
1996-05-31 0:00 ` Robert I. Eachus
1996-06-03 0:00 ` Ralph Paul
replies disabled
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ox